Update now! Apple fixes major security flaw in iPhone, iPad, and more with these software versions

Apple earlier this week released iOS 18.6, iPadOS 18.6, macOS Sequoia 15.6, tvOS 18.6, watchOS 11.6, and visionOS 2.6. It is vital to download these software versions, as they patch a critical vulnerability that could potentially leave you exposed to hackers, and get in undue trouble. Here's what you need to know. iOS 18.6 fixes a big security loophole(Shaurya Sharma - HT) What is this security flaw? The specific flaw is CVE-2025-6558, which allows remote hackers to execute arbitrary code using a crafted HTML page, enabling them to bypass browser security, as spotted by Bleeping Computer. This vulnerability affects browsers such as Chrome, where it was identified as a zero-day vulnerability. It was reportedly first spotted by Google's Threat Analysis Group in June, and the Google Chrome team ultimately patched it in July. To be safe, you simply need to update to the appropriate software version for your device. If you have an iPhone that supports iOS 18.6, you should update to it as soon as possible to avoid any potential security issues. Similarly, if you are using an iPad, update to iPadOS 18.6, and do likewise for other Apple devices. It is also worth noting that Apple does not disclose or discuss security issues until patches are released. Which devices are compatible with iOS 18.6? If your device is already running an iOS 18 version, it will be compatible with iOS 18.6. This means all iPhones from the iPhone XS to the latest iPhone 16 series will receive this update. If you are using an older device that is not compatible with iOS 18 versions, it is in your best interest to upgrade to a newer model that supports the latest software to prevent security vulnerabilities. Apple Releases Update for iPhone, iPad With ‘Important Bug Fixes and Security Updates'

Apple Inc. released roughly 30 security fixes for the iPhone, iPad, and other devices after some flaws were discovered, including one that could exploit the engine that runs the Safari web browser, the company said on Tuesday. The security update was issued as part of the company's move to release iOS 18.6 and iPadOS 18.6, which impact later-model iPhone and iPad models, respectively.

iOS 18 update now available: Crucial for iPhone users to prevent serious problems

Apple has released a critical software update, iOS 18.6, for iPhone users, patching over 20 security vulnerabilities that could potentially expose sensitive data, crash apps, or allow unauthorised access to device functions. Although no active exploits have been reported yet, experts are urging users to install the update immediately to avoid future risks. Another vulnerability, related to the handling of maliciously crafted audio files, could lead to memory corruption and system instability. These could allow attackers to steal personal information, crash the Safari browser, or manipulate web content in ways that were not intended. WebKit is the underlying engine for Safari and many other apps, making these fixes particularly significant. A must-install for iPhone and iPad users Apple has made the iOS 18.6 and iPadOS 18.6 updates available to all compatible devices, including iPhone 11 models and newer, and iPads that support iPadOS 18. Users on older iPads who are unable to upgrade to iPadOS 18.6 can instead download iPadOS 17.7.9, which includes many of the same crucial fixes. To install the update, go to Settings > General > Software Update and follow the on-screen instructions. Apple recommends backing up your device beforehand to avoid any data loss during installation. macOS Sequoia and more receive parallel updates The company has also released macOS Sequoia 15.6, which fixes over 80 security vulnerabilities, along with updates for macOS Sonoma (14.7.7) and macOS Ventura (13.7.7) for older Macs. Other platforms, including watchOS 11.6, tvOS 18.6, and visionOS 2.6, also received important security patches. Why this update matters Though none of the vulnerabilities have been actively exploited "in the wild", Apple emphasises the importance of staying up to date. A single unpatched bug can offer attackers a backdoor into your device. As Apple stated in its security bulletin: 'Installing the latest software updates is one of the most important steps users can take to protect their devices and personal information.' In short, if you're using an iPhone, download iOS 18.6 now, it could save you from serious trouble down the line.
